Legend of Cougar Canyon (1976)
There are many wonderful and dangerous legends about Cougar Canyon, a sacred Navajo terrain. Two young boys must face the legends and dangers when they go to rescue a lost goat.
Directing:
Writing:
Stars:
- James T. Flocker
Writing:
- James T. Flocker
Stars:
Release Date: 1976-04-19
5.5/10
- Language: English
- Runtime: 91